Goodberry is a Spell in Baldur's Gate 3. Goodberry is a Lvl 1 Spell from the Transmutation school. Spells can be used for dealing damage to Enemies, inflict Status Ailments, buff Characters or interact with the environment.
Goodberry Information
- Description: Conjure four magical berries into your or a companion's inventory. Creatures who eat a berry regain 1~4 hit points. Berries disappear after a Long Rest.
- Level: Lvl 1 spell
- School: Transmutation School
- Casting Time: Action
- Range: Melee
- Requires Concentration: No
- Saving Throw: None

Goodberry Tips & Notes
- You can use the created Goodberry as a Camp Supply Sack resource, each berry giving you 1 Camp Supply Sack.

I got a weird question regarding Goodberries.
Do they count as a character healing another player or do they count as a consumable?
My hypothesis here is that if it counts toward player healing, you could combine it with the gauntlets that provide blade ward on healing, or the ring that provides 1D4 to attack rolls and saving throws when healing. So when you're in a pickle in combat, a character could consume a Goodberry to gain the benefits of Bladeward and Bless.
